How much do project program management advisor j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for project program management advisor in Missouri is $47.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$31.40 and $58.41 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Project Program Management Advisor vs Project Coordinator?

AspectProject Program Management AdvisorProject Coordinator
CredentialsPM certifications (PMP, PgMP), relevant experienceBasic project management training, associate degrees often sufficient
Work EnvironmentStrategic planning, stakeholder engagement, high-level oversightAdministrative support, task tracking, meeting coordination
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in consulting firms, large corporations, project management officesCommon in construction, IT, and corporate project teams

The Project Program Management Advisor focuses on strategic oversight, managing multiple projects, and stakeholder communication, often requiring advanced certifications. In contrast, the Project Coordinator handles day-to-day administrative tasks, supporting project managers. Both roles are essential but differ in scope, responsibilities, and required credentials.

Job Summary:

We are looking for a highly motivated Program Manager that is a selfโ€‘starter and is passionate about leading and partnering with crossโ€‘functional teams. The Program Manager will ensure the execution of the Monarch Bronchoscopy program, develop and manage project timelines, lead meetings, set and drive quarterly goals, and identify and mitigate program risks.

This position must be located in Santa Clara, CA.

Responsibilities:
  • Own and drive the progress of Monarch Bronchoscopy product development programs
  • Organize regular team meetings to drive progress, track and mitigate risks, resolve/escalate issues, and review action items
  • Actively plan and drive crossโ€‘functional project teams to deliver against integrated, detailed plans within budget and timelines
  • Enable proactive communications with directors and managers, ensuring integration of projects, and achievement of program milestones
  • Proactively identify program and technical risks, generate mitigation plans, and facilitate the closure of risks
  • Build team ownership and dedication to projects and business plans
  • Prepare regular updates for J&J Robotics & Digital Solutions management team on progress of assigned projects.
  • Allocate tasks among project specific team members and lead team to complete objectives.
  • Coordinate and drive efforts with external vendors, including coโ€‘development and subcontracted development if required.
Experience and key competencies:Required:
  • BS/BA in Engineering or related technical field
  • 7+ years of experience in a regulated environment
  • 3+ years of experience in program or project management
  • Experience working on complex systems or in complex dynamic teams
  • Experience with using and/or administering project management software
  • Work independently and be selfโ€‘motivated with a strong sense of urgency and drive for results
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Comfortable and adaptable in presenting to different audiences and levels of the organization
  • Ability to travel up to 10%, international and domestic
Preferred:
  • MS or PhD in Engineering, Science, or Business
  • Experience leading earlyโ€‘stage development teams
  • Exposure to business case development and user requirement identification
  • Experience with Medical Device Design Control, QSR 21 CFR Part 820, Medical Devices and Regulatory strategies for FDA and 510k along with CE Mark
  • Experience as an individual contributor in an engineering role within medical device design and development
  • PMP Certification
